Description: ZZW-115 HCl is a potent NUPR1 inhibitor. ZZW-115 induces ferroptosis in a mitochondria-dependent manner. ZZW-115 induces ROS accumulation followed by a ferroptotic cell death, which could be prevented by ferrostatin-1 (Fer-1) and ROS-scavenging agents. In addition, ZZW-115-treatment increases the accumulation of hydroperoxided lipids in these cells. ZZW-115-induced mitochondrial morphological changes, compatible with the ferroptotic process, as well as mitochondrial network disorganization and strong mitochondrial metabolic dysfunction, which are rescued by both Fer-1 and N-acetylcysteine (NAC). Of note, the expression of TFAM, a key regulator of mitochondrial biogenesis, is downregulated by ZZW-115.
